Your future responsibilities

You’ll join (Engineering System) the Telemetry team.
 
The Telemetry team is a fast-moving agile team with a DevOps mindset with the benefits of working in a large organization. Our goal is to increase transparency of activities in the IT development organization by supporting developers and leaders with situation awareness of systems and progresses.
 
 
What you’ll be doing:
- Cleaning and mining the collected data
- Data storage
- Machine Learning, Natural Language Processing and statistics
- Making dashboards and reports
